Wilton to install piping for sludge with PFAS contaminants
With the implementation of LD 1911, “An Act To Prevent the Further Contamination of the Soils and Waters of the State with So-called Forever Chemicals,” use of any sludge from wastewater treatment plants is prohibited.
Two Massachusetts men escape with scrapes after SUV goes off U.S. Route 2 in Wilton
Driver Darlin Rosario fell asleep at the wheel, according to Chief Heidi Wilcox said. He and a passenger told police they had just finished working a 12-hour shift.
